Topiramate: From Epilepsy to Trigeminal Nerve Neoplasm

One-Sentence Summary

Topiramate is a well-established second-generation anticonvulsant, originally developed for the treatment of partial-onset and generalized epilepsy (and later migraine prophylaxis). The TxGNN model's top-ranked prediction proposes it may be effective for Trigeminal Nerve Neoplasm, but currently 0 clinical trials and 0 publications support this specific link — this is a model-score-only signal with no corroborating evidence.

Why is This Prediction Reasonable?

Detailed mechanism of action data for topiramate is not available in this evidence pack (drug-level MOA field is a documented data gap). Based on the literature captured elsewhere in this pack, topiramate is known to act on multiple targets — voltage-gated sodium and calcium channels, GABA-A receptors, AMPA/kainate glutamate receptors, and carbonic anhydrase isoenzymes — which together underlie its broad-spectrum antiseizure and migraine-preventive effects.

Trigeminal nerve neoplasm (typically a schwannoma or other nerve-sheath tumor) is a structurally and pathologically distinct condition from epilepsy or migraine. None of topiramate's known ion-channel or enzyme-inhibitory mechanisms have an established link to tumor suppression, and no preclinical or clinical literature in this evidence pack connects topiramate to neoplastic disease of the trigeminal nerve.

By contrast, several lower-ranked TxGNN predictions for topiramate (e.g., visual epilepsy, thinking seizures, reading seizures, audiogenic seizures — ranks 2–9) are directly consistent with topiramate's known antiepileptic pharmacology and are backed by substantial clinical trial and literature evidence. This suggests the model's top-ranked "novel" indication (trigeminal nerve neoplasm) lacks the biological plausibility and evidentiary support seen in its other, more conventional seizure-related predictions.
